OpenAI agrees to strengthen safeguards following B.C. mass shooting: minister
March 4, 2026
Minister Evan Solomon says Sam Altman confirmed the company would apply its new safety standards retroactively and review previously flagged cases.

CANBERRA — Prime Minister Mark Carney says Canada will “defend our allies” when it comes to Iran, not ruling out future military participation.
He also stands by his decision not to call for a de-escalation in hostiles when he initially threw Canada’s support behind the U.S strikes, with he and his ministers spending the days since underscoring that the tensions must begin to lower.
“In terms of war, there are likelihoods, there are possibilities, you have to plan for the worst, but there are no certainties, in conflict,” he told reporters outside of Australia’s parliament, citing...
